EDUCATION NEWS
- ➤ Superintendent Matt Fisher presented a preliminary three-phase facility plan at the Feb. 12 Board meeting, detailing Phase 1 renovations at Gates Elementary beginning Fall 2026 and future upgrades at middle and high schools via bond elections (public feedback is requested) (enrollment growth is projected). GOVERNMENT NEWS
- ➤ Grand Island Public Schools Board of Education approved video security upgrades at 12 district buildings by an 8-0 vote after Dan Petsch's presentation. The project will enhance safety at several schools and cost about $1.56 million. Central Nebraska Today
